Senior Software Engineer (Python)

4 - 8 years

0 Lacs

Posted:2 days ago| Platform: Shine log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

Recruiterflow is an AI-first RecOps platform tailored for ambitious agencies, providing an integrated ATS & CRM with automation features to enhance RecOps efficiency. The platform revolutionizes recruiting agency operations by streamlining hiring into a structured sales process, leading to quicker position closures, superior talent engagement, and seamless scalability. Currently positioned among the top 5 industry players, our aspiration is to ascend to the top 3 echelon within the next three years. We are in search of an adept and seasoned Senior Software Developer proficient in Python to augment our vibrant development team. In this role, as a Senior Software Developer, you will assume a pivotal position in conceptualizing, executing, and upholding robust and scalable software solutions. Embark on this journey with us if you are driven to aid in crafting innovative solutions and integrating state-of-the-art technology to bridge the recruitment divide. Location: Bengaluru (On-site) Responsibilities: - Design, develop, test, and maintain high-performance and scalable software solutions using Python. - Collaborate with cross-functional teams to delineate, create, and deploy new features. - Innovate and refine AI-based solutions for addressing customer issues. - Conduct comprehensive code reviews to ensure code quality, compliance with coding standards, and implementation of best practices. - Advocate for and implement best practices in coding, testing, and documentation. - Formulate and uphold comprehensive technical documentation for software architecture, design, and implementation. - Enhance software for optimal speed and scalability, ensuring peak performance. - Identify and tackle bottlenecks and performance challenges. - Provide technical guidance and mentorship to junior developers. - Engage in architectural decisions and contribute to the overarching technical roadmap. Qualifications: - Bachelor's or Master's degree in Computer Science, Software Engineering, or a related discipline. - Over 4 years of demonstrated experience as a Senior Software Developer focusing on Python development. - Profound proficiency in Python and related frameworks (Django, Flask, etc.). - Extensive exposure to database systems like PostgreSQL, MySQL, or MongoDB. - Sound comprehension of software development methodologies and best practices. - Familiarity with front-end technologies (JavaScript, HTML, CSS) is advantageous. - Acquaintance with version control systems (Git) and continuous integration/deployment pipelines. - Exceptional problem-solving and debugging acumen. - Strong communication and collaboration aptitude.,

Mock Interview

Practice Video Interview with JobPe AI

Start Python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Python Skills

Practice Python coding challenges to boost your skills

Start Practicing Python Now

RecommendedJobs for You